Exploring Funk Carioca: The Beat of Rio’s Favelas
Funk Carioca, often referred to as Brazilian funk, is a genre of music that has its roots deeply embedded in the favelas (slums) of Rio de Janeiro, Brazil. With its infectious rhythms, rapid beats, and gritty lyrics, Funk Carioca has become a cultural force, reflecting the raw energy and the socio-political realities of life in these communities. The genre blends Brazilian funk, rap, and electronic dance music (EDM), creating a high-energy sound that resonates with both the young and the old, locally and globally.
The Sounds and Rhythms of Funk Carioca
Funk Carioca is distinct for its heavy beats and fast tempos, which are perfect for dancing and often featured in the energetic parties and celebrations of Rio de Janeiro’s streets. However, what sets this genre apart is its unapologetic and often politically charged lyrics. The songs speak to the daily struggles of life in the favelas, addressing issues such as poverty, violence, and social inequality, all while providing a sense of empowerment and resilience to the community.
While its roots are humble, Funk Carioca has expanded far beyond the favelas of Rio, finding a place in nightclubs, radio stations, and international stages. The genre's ability to transcend its local origins and reach a global audience has made it one of the most influential music styles to emerge from Brazil in recent decades.
Radio Stations Championing Funk Carioca
Radio stations dedicated to Funk Carioca can be found across Brazil, with many based in Rio de Janeiro, the genre's birthplace. These stations play a crucial role in promoting the music, culture, and artists behind Funk Carioca, offering listeners a direct link to the latest tracks, trends, and discussions surrounding the genre.
One of the most well-known stations is Radio FM O Dia, which broadcasts in Rio de Janeiro and various other Brazilian cities. This station is a go-to for Funk Carioca fans, offering a diverse mix of the genre, alongside other popular Brazilian styles such as samba and pagode. The station also provides valuable community updates, including news and traffic reports, and features live interviews with musicians, celebrities, and prominent figures in Brazilian pop culture.
Another prominent station is Rádio Favela, based in Belo Horizonte. This station blends Funk Carioca with hip-hop, creating an eclectic mix that draws listeners from various demographics. Along with its music programming, Rádio Favela delivers important local community news and information, further connecting listeners to their neighborhoods and beyond.
Rádio Transamérica, with stations across several Brazilian cities, also plays a significant role in the Funk Carioca scene. This station incorporates the genre into its broader music mix, which includes pop, rock, and other genres, while also providing celebrity interviews and daily news updates.
Funk Carioca: More Than Just a Sound
The impact of Funk Carioca extends far beyond music. It is a platform for social expression, a voice for marginalized communities, and a way for listeners to connect with the raw realities of life in Brazil’s favelas. The genre is not only an outlet for entertainment but also for political commentary, often confronting issues such as poverty, police brutality, and inequality in Brazil’s urban environments.
Funk Carioca has garnered global attention, with many artists now performing on international stages and collaborations crossing borders. The genre continues to evolve, with newer artists incorporating electronic sounds and global music influences, while still maintaining the core elements of Funk Carioca that have made it so relatable and distinctive.
